00:11 - Yeah, it's all the stuff that you weigh
00:13 when you're making that decision.
00:14 Do you, you know, there is risk to go out there
00:18 and potentially reinjure it,
00:20 but there's also a risk to go out there and be 0-3.
00:22 So I wanted to be out there for my guys,
00:25 and, you know, I was confident that I would be able
00:27 to do what I needed to, to get the win.

00:57 - Joe, how challenging has it been
00:58 trying to get explosive plays down the field?
01:01 You guys haven't hit much,
01:02 it's been such a big part of your offense in recent years.
01:05 And is that kind of a source of frustration
01:07 for you right now,
01:07 that you guys haven't been able to get those?
01:09 - Yeah, I mean, those are, obviously make it a lot easier,
01:13 but we've played three really good defenses
01:16 that know that that's what we're good at,
01:19 and are good at taking that away.
01:21 And then, you know, when you're able to extend plays,
01:26 kind of explosive plays are created in that way.
01:30 And so I think, you know, going forward,
01:32 the healthier I get, the more we'll be able to do that.
